Output 08689aa7b625e36e3d20b0ff7bf7b39cd3105ab2df85b85255fc947f135861aa:4

value
54609856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9623055fa9e0a12d1b05192898ef8a9b405b8ef8 OP_EQUAL
address
MMb1YWHyK1QKD3tWKLCTMg9kQ46UA2ns6s
transaction
08689aa7b625e36e3d20b0ff7bf7b39cd3105ab2df85b85255fc947f135861aa
spent
true